Mature Height and Spread

Typical Dimensions 🌱

Sunn hemp is a remarkable plant that can reach impressive heights, typically ranging from 3 to 10 feet (0.9 to 3 meters). Its mature spread usually falls between 2 to 4 feet (0.6 to 1.2 meters), making it a robust addition to any garden or agricultural setting.

Growth Rate and Time to Maturity

🌱 Growth Rate

Sunn hemp is known for its rapid growth, often reaching impressive heights in as little as 60 days when conditions are just right. This makes it a standout choice compared to many traditional legumes and cover crops, which typically take longer to establish.

⏳ Time to Maturity

From planting to full maturity, sunn hemp generally takes about 90 to 120 days. You'll know it's time to harvest when you see the flowering stage and the development of seed pods, both clear indicators that the plant has reached its peak.

Size Variability Based on Conditions

🌍 Environmental Factors

The size of sunn hemp can vary significantly based on environmental conditions. In nutrient-poor soils, you might see plants only reaching 3 to 4 feet, while fertile soils can boost growth to impressive heights of 8 to 10 feet.

Water availability plays a crucial role as well. Drought stress can severely stunt growth, making consistent moisture essential for achieving optimal plant size.

β˜€οΈ Sunlight Requirements

Sunlight is another key player in determining the size of sunn hemp. Full sun exposure, ideally 6 to 8 hours daily, leads to maximum height and spread, allowing these plants to thrive.

On the flip side, sunn hemp has limited shade tolerance. When grown in shaded areas, you can expect smaller plants that don’t reach their full potential.

🌑️ Climate and Temperature Effects

The ideal temperature range for sunn hemp growth is between 70Β°F to 95Β°F (21Β°C to 35Β°C). Within this range, plants flourish, reaching their full potential.

However, extreme temperatures can have varying effects. High heat can accelerate growth, while frost can cause significant damage, hindering the plant's development.
